Breast Cancer Screening



Investigators at Meharry Medical College, Medical College release new data on breast cancer screening



August 7th, 2008

"Recruiting underserved women in breast cancer research studies remains a significant challenge. We present our experience attempting to locate and recruit minority and medically underserved women identified in a Nashville, Tennessee public hospital for a mammography follow-up study," researchers in the United States report.

"The study design was a retrospective hospital-based case-control study. We identified 227 women (88 African-American, 65 Caucasian, 36 other minority, 38 race undocumented in the medical record) who had undergone screening mammography and received an abnormal result during 2003-2004. Of the 227 women identified, 159 women were successfully located...
